The Atlantic high pressure system will dominate the weather conditions across SVG within the next 3 days. Although sporadic episodes of isolated showers are anticipated, generally warm conditions are likely to continue as the nature of these showers are expected to be short lived.

Gentle to fresh (15 – 30km/h) south-easterly trades will cross our islands before shifting to east north easterly from Friday. A decrease (10-25km/h) in wind speed is also forecast as well.

Marine conditions are slight to moderate with swells ranging 1.0m to 1.5m across our islands, gradually falling to near 1.2m by Saturday. No significant haze intrusion is anticipated within this forecast period.
